The Rise of Smart Warehousing

Smart warehousing leverages automation, data analytics, and connectivity to optimize every aspect of logistics—from receiving goods to storage and distribution. With the growing demand for real-time visibility, companies are implementing automated warehouse systems that minimize manual intervention and errors. Additionally, IoT storage solutions enable continuous monitoring of inventory conditions and movements, ensuring faster and more reliable operations.

The evolution of smart logistics is further amplified by the adoption of AI-based predictive analytics, allowing businesses to forecast demand accurately and allocate resources efficiently. As global e-commerce continues to boom, the need for warehouse automation has become central to supply chain optimization, particularly for enterprises seeking agility, scalability, and cost efficiency.

Technological Innovations Driving Market Growth

One of the most significant contributors to the expansion of the smart warehousing industry is the integration of inventory management robots and autonomous guided vehicles (AGVs). These machines can efficiently pick, pack, and transport items within the facility, reducing downtime and improving throughput.

Moreover, digital twin technology and predictive maintenance are helping warehouse operators manage assets proactively, preventing operational disruptions. FAQs

1. What factors are driving the growth of the Smart Warehousing Market Size?
The main drivers include increasing e-commerce activities, demand for real-time inventory tracking, and advancements in IoT and AI technologies, which enable better automation and decision-making.

2. How does IoT impact smart warehousing operations?
IoT allows for real-time monitoring of inventory, equipment, and environmental conditions, enhancing visibility, efficiency, and accuracy across the supply chain.

3. What role do robots play in warehouse automation?
Robots and automated systems handle repetitive and labor-intensive tasks such as picking, sorting, and transporting goods, reducing human errors and operational costs while improving overall productivity.
